What is an error page?
An error page appears when you have misspelled a page or the page you requested has been deleted. When the user is being referred from another site or by any other way, this could cause the user to just hit the “back” button and not go into your site. That, is not good.
Step #1: Create the error page however you’d like. An image or just a text, but make sure you have somewhere they can click to continue to navigate your site. After that save it as you save any other page.
Step #2 Locate your .htaccess file on your server. It should be in the main directory. Download it to your computer and open it in notepad. If it’s not there just open notepad.
Step #3: Type: ErrorDocument 404 http://www.domain.ext/yourerrorpage.ext . Substitute the url I put with the url for the page you created. After that, upload it. If you opened a blank notepad page, than click ’save as’ and in the filename type “.htaccess” with the quotation marks. Upload it, and you’re done!
